Unidade externa montada através de fstab, permissão negada mesmo com sudo

1

Eu segui o link e montei meu driver externo do Seagate assim:

PARTUUID=225d3878-01  /media/external ntfs    defaults,auto,umask=000,users,rw 0 0

Eu tentei UUID=... , mas não funcionou, sempre me deu erros de inicialização, não consegui acessar o shell.

Dessa forma, ele inicializa, mas quando vou para /media e faço ls -la :

drwxrwxrwx  1 root root 4096 May  7 18:52 external

externo é marcado em verde, como se fosse diferente de outras coisas. Eu recebo Permission Denied quando tento gravar nele, mesmo com o sudo, mas as permissões são 777 .

Como alterar essas permissões para outras menos permissivas e torná-las graváveis pelo meu usuário?

    
por Guerlando OCs 07.05.2018 / 21:01

1 resposta

2

Eu também uso um Pi e também anexo um disco rígido externo.

Para trabalhar com o NTFS, você precisa de outras duas ferramentas:

sudo apt install ntfs-3g fuse

e depois você pode montar sua unidade com o
-t ntfs-3g # é necessário para obter acesso de leitura e gravação às unidades ntfs
-o #are algumas opções
-uid = 1000 #é o id do meu usuário principal, você também pode usar nomes
-gid = 100 # group id dos usuários para simplificar -então precisamos de uma fonte meu usb-stick com ntfs está localizado na SDC e a parição é SDC1
-o último ponto é o destino e eu quero em / mnt / usbstick

sudo mount -t ntfs-3g -o uid=1000,gid=100 /dev/sdc1 /mnt/usb-stick

Portanto, a resposta ao seu Qestion é NTFS-3G em vez de NTFS.

Se isso estiver funcionando, você também pode usá-lo no seu fstab.

Dica: O NTFS-3G sempre ajusta o nível de acesso para 777, portanto, se a pasta estiver verde: -)

br chris

br chris

    
por WiKrIe 07.05.2018 / 22:09